QAnon Rep Marjorie Taylor Greene outrageously claims Hillary Clinton and Nancy Pelosi ‘orchestrate school shootings’
GEORGIA Rep Marjorie Taylor Greene claimed that Hillary Clinton and Nancy Pelosi “orchestrated” school shootings in a wild conspiracy theory posted to Facebook.
Greene, who is also known for supporting QAnon and for getting suspended from Twitter within months of getting elected, made the claims in a 2018 Facebook post.

The post was unearthed by Media Matters on Tuesday.
The rep also suggested that the shooting at Marjory Stoneman Douglas High School in Parkland, Florida, which killed 17 people, was fake.
Greene enthusiastically agreed with a post that stated that the people involved in the Parkland shooting were paid, and it was a “false flag” event.

The theory states that Donald Trump was trying to stop the ring.
After winning her primary runoff in August 2020, Greene tried to distance herself from the widely debunked theory, telling Fox News that QAnon does not “represent” her and “wasn’t part of my campaign.”

Greene’s account was suspended for only 12 hours.
In comparison, Trump’s account was suspended permanently after the Capitol riots.
As soon as the ban was lifted, she returned to the platform to slam the company and other tech giants for playing “God.”

“Contrary to how highly you think of yourself and your moral platitude, you are not the judge of humanity. God is,” she wrote.
“And you and the rest of your pals from the Silicon Valley Cartel are not God. Difficult for you to grasp I know, however it’s the truth.”
Greene has also said she will file for impeachment on Joe Biden’s first day in office, January 20.
